#279106 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#279106 is composed of 15.3% red, 56.9%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 73.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 95.9% yellow and 43.1% black. It has a hue angle of 105.8 degrees, a saturation of 92.1% and a lightness of 29.6%. #279106 color hex could be obtained by blending #4eff0c with #002300.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

#279106 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#279106 has RGB values of R:39, G:145, B:6 and CMYK values of C:0.73, M:0, Y:0.96,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 2593030.
